		<description>Flax seed is great for you but I think you should consider fish oil or krill oil if you want to increase your good omega 3&#039;s DHA and EPA.  The ALA found in Flax seed is supposed to be inefficient at converting to DHA and EPA.  Flax seed however is excellent for you if you grind it right before eating.  It has great levels of fiber.  Fiber is great and can keep things moving.  Flax seed also contains Lignans which have been implicated in anti cancer and other health benefits.  So increase your flax seed intake but think about fish and krill oil for increasing your good omega 3&#039;s</description>
